On June 29th, HP announced that it will expand its strategic partnership with OpenAI Frontier and officially push for enterprise-level deployment after achieving success in a series of pilot projects. The collaboration covers various core business areas such as customer service, partner experience, employee productivity, and software development. The pilot phase has already shown significant results: an engineer processed 122 pull requests out of 43 projects in just a few weeks, the security team compressed the month-long vulnerability patching work to one day, and the security team can release about 82 hours of work efficiency per week. HP positions Frontier as a unified platform connecting access permissions, business context, deployment processes, and effectiveness evaluation. Key application scenarios include channel ecosystem services covering over 100,000 partners, device telemetry data analysis and fault diagnosis, and enterprise-level network security protection. HP stated that AI is becoming the new foundational layer of company operations, and Frontier will drive its transition from pilot results to full enterprise-scale transformation.
